The Rise of Electric Vehicles
Electric vehicles are at the forefront of the transportation revolution. With major automotive manufacturers investing heavily in EV technology, the market is witnessing unprecedented growth. The benefits of EVs extend beyond reducing carbon emissions; they also offer:
- Reduced fuel costs: Electricity is generally cheaper than gasoline.
- Lower maintenance expenses: Fewer moving parts mean less wear and tear.
- Government incentives: Many regions provide tax benefits and rebates for EV purchases.
- Enhanced technology: EVs often come equipped with the latest technological advancements.
As battery technology improves, the range of electric vehicles continues to expand, addressing one of the primary concerns consumers have regarding their adoption. The new generation of EVs promises not only performance but also convenience, making it increasingly easier for consumers to make the transition.
Sustainable Alternatives on the Rise
While electric vehicles are gaining popularity, various sustainable alternatives are also emerging, enhancing the future landscape of transportation. These alternatives include:
- Hydrogen Fuel Cell Vehicles: Utilizing hydrogen as a clean fuel source, these vehicles emit only water vapor.
- Public Transportation Innovations: Smart and efficient mass transit systems reduce individual car dependency.
- Bicycles and E-Bikes: Growing infrastructure and urban designs encourage cycling and its alternative powered forms.
- Car Sharing and Ride-hailing Services: Facilitating shared transport, which can reduce the number of vehicles on the road.
Each of these sustainable alternatives contributes to reducing environmental impact and enhancing urban mobility. By diversifying our transportation methods, we can further mitigate transportation’s carbon footprint.

Challenges to Overcome
Despite the promising advancements in electric vehicles and sustainable alternatives, several challenges remain. Key issues include:
- Infrastructure: Adequate charging stations and support systems are still needed in many areas.
- Public perception: Misconceptions about EVs’ capabilities can hinder adoption.
- Initial costs: Although prices are dropping, the upfront cost of EVs is still a concern for many consumers.
Addressing these challenges is essential for the widespread acceptance of electric vehicles and other sustainable transport methods. Collaboration among government, industry, and communities will be crucial in overcoming these hurdles.
